Polygon, previously known as Matic Network, is a Layer 2 scaling solution for Ethereum that aims to provide faster and cheaper transactions. Launched in 2017, Polygon has grown rapidly, becoming one of the most prominent solutions for scalability and interoperability in the blockchain space. By utilizing sidechains and a Proof-of-Stake consensus mechanism, Polygon can process thousands of transactions per second with minimal fees. This efficiency has made it a favorite among developers and users alike, particularly for applications in DeFi (Decentralized Finance) and gaming.

CryptoGames offers a variety of features designed to enhance the gaming experience. The platform supports 10 in-house games, including Dice, Dicev2, Roulette, Blackjack, Lottery, Video Poker, Plinko, Minesweeper, and Keno. Each game is designed with a specific house edge, ensuring fairness and transparency. For instance, Keno and Dice games have a house edge of 1.0%, while Roulette has a 2.7% house edge. Video Poker offers three variations with house edges ranging from 2.08% to 2.11%, and other games like Blackjack and Plinko also maintain competitive house edges.
